Nightmares Of The Deep

By Sage FearPublished 11 days ago 2 min read

Hiding in the darkest corners of the mind.

Creatures so terrifying, only appearing at night. As you fall into slumber, they crawl out.

Clawing and dragging themselves to release the fright.

They bear no expression, yet have long limbs, they sound like crackling bones as they climb around.

Embodying the darkest thoughts, they twist them to the worst. Dragging back long forgotten traumas, and making them horrifying. Images so twisted, so dark and so gruesome.

You can't escape. Run as long as you want, they follow you everywhere. The more fear you release, the more of them appear. They grow in numbers, slowly closing in.

Beware, as something much more sinister lurks. It hides in the farthest part of the mind. When it shows, darkness flows, covering every inch of the area around. There is no body, there are no limbs, as far as you can see that is. It hides its true form, wanting to savor your fear.

Trapped and unable to move, your legs refuse to listen. The creature, with the glowing eyes and twisted smile, observes as you struggle. It decides to move closer, the shadows following. The smaller creatures move away, giving space for the leader.

You can't move. It lets out a deep chuckle. As it reaches for you with claws so thin and long. You see the points, attached to a bony arm. Glancing up, you meet its eyes. The glowing yellow has no pupils, yet you can feel its stare.

It enjoys every minute it has you trapped. A rolling laugh begins to erupt, the mouth opening wide. Even inside the mouth is a black void of nothing.

It moves even closer, your breath getting shorter and faster.

Can't move. Can't talk. Can't scream. Eyes wide, unable to look away, you watch this monster come even closer.

Its eyes are huge, unblinking, and cold. It has no smell, yet has breath.

You awake. Covered in a cold sweat, tears rolling down your face. Breathing heavily, you wonder if they will be back.

They will. They always come back. The creatures that live in the darkest corners.

You can't escape.
